9. Automatic Reasoning and Tool use
Automatic Reasoning and Tool use
Automatic Reasoning and Tool use involves instructing language models to perform logical reasoning or use specific tools to solve problems, enabling them to demonstrate practical problem-solving skills.
- Example: Prompting a model with “Solve this math problem” or “Use a virtual tool to design a simple illustration.”
15 different types of Automatic Reasoning and Tool-use prompts for Chat GPT
- Medical Diagnosis Assistant: “Given the patient’s symptoms and medical history, provide a probable diagnosis along with recommended treatment options.”
- Financial Portfolio Optimizer: “Based on the investor’s risk tolerance and financial goals, recommend an optimal allocation strategy for their investment portfolio.”
- Code Debugger: “Identify and fix errors in the provided code snippet, and provide an explanation of the debugging process.”
- Legal Document Generator: “Generate a legally binding contract tailored to the specifications provided, including clauses for terms and conditions, liabilities, and obligations.”
- Recipe Recommendation Engine: “Suggest personalized recipes based on dietary preferences, ingredient availability, and desired cuisine type.”
- Language Translation Assistant: “Translate the given text from English to Spanish while preserving the original meaning and context.”
- Customer Service Chatbot: “Respond to customer inquiries and resolve issues related to product troubleshooting, billing inquiries, or account management.”
- Project Management Tool Integration: “Integrate task updates from various project management tools (e.g., Trello, Asana) and provide a summary of project progress and next steps.”
- Resume Builder: “Generate a professional resume tailored to the user’s skills, work experience, and career objectives.”
- Virtual Tutor: “Provide step-by-step explanations and practice problems to help students understand and master complex mathematical concepts.”
- AI-driven Personal Assistant: “Assist users with scheduling appointments, setting reminders, and managing daily tasks using natural language commands.”
- Travel Planner: “Recommend personalized travel itineraries based on budget, destination preferences, and desired activities.”
- Data Analysis Tool: “Analyze the provided dataset and generate insights, trends, and visualizations to aid decision-making in business or research.”
- Code Autocomplete: “Automatically suggest code snippets and completions based on the context and programming language being used.”
- Symptom Checker: “Assess the user’s symptoms and provide recommendations for further medical evaluation or treatment options.”